I am new to this forum and would appreciate I the help I can get. I have an 89 century custom 3.3 V6. The starter was starting to go bad on me in Vegas last weekend, so I tested everything and concluded the starter is bad. So I raise the front wheels and find that the two bolts holding on the starter have to be lossened from underneath. So I got the one towards the front loose but i cannot get the one in the back loose without removing the oil pan, So I began doing that and cant get one bolt out which is under the crankcase pulley.

Anyone ever changed a starter like this if so any tips or tricks?
